Bitcoin Mining Explained: Why We Need Proof of Work

Bitcoin Mining Explained: Why We Need Proof of WorkWhat exactly is Bitcoin Mining and why does it consume energy? It’s not just about solving math problems—it’s about solving the “Byzantine Generals Problem” to create digital trust without a central bank. In this video, we break down the engineering behind Bitcoin Mining, Proof of Work, and the Hash Lottery.
